diff --git a/packages/core/src/components.d.ts b/packages/core/src/components.d.ts index 830de6cdc7..d45f44b0ab 100644 --- a/packages/core/src/components.d.ts +++ b/packages/core/src/components.d.ts @@ -2379,7 +2379,7 @@ declare global { import { RouteLink as IonRouteLink -} from './components/router/route-link'; +} from './components/route-link/route-link'; declare global { interface HTMLIonRouteLinkElement extends IonRouteLink, HTMLElement { @@ -2411,7 +2411,7 @@ declare global { import { Route as IonRoute -} from './components/router/route'; +} from './components/route/route'; declare global { interface HTMLIonRouteElement extends IonRoute, HTMLElement { @@ -2444,7 +2444,7 @@ declare global { import { RouterController as IonRouterController -} from './components/router/router-controller'; +} from './components/router-controller/router-controller'; declare global { interface HTMLIonRouterControllerElement extends IonRouterController, HTMLElement { diff --git a/packages/core/src/components/router/readme.md b/packages/core/src/components/route-link/readme.md similarity index 100% rename from packages/core/src/components/router/readme.md rename to packages/core/src/components/route-link/readme.md diff --git a/packages/core/src/components/router/route-link.tsx b/packages/core/src/components/route-link/route-link.tsx similarity index 100% rename from packages/core/src/components/router/route-link.tsx rename to packages/core/src/components/route-link/route-link.tsx diff --git a/packages/core/src/components/route/readme.md b/packages/core/src/components/route/readme.md new file mode 100644 index 0000000000..40c66748d3 --- /dev/null +++ b/packages/core/src/components/route/readme.md @@ -0,0 +1,53 @@ +# ion-route + + + + + + +## Properties + +#### component + +string + + +#### path + +string + + +#### props + +any + + +## Attributes + +#### component + +string + + +#### path + +string + + +#### props + +any + + +## Events + +#### ionRouteAdded + + +#### ionRouteRemoved + + + +---------------------------------------------- + +*Built by [StencilJS](https://stenciljs.com/)* diff --git a/packages/core/src/components/router/route.tsx b/packages/core/src/components/route/route.tsx similarity index 88% rename from packages/core/src/components/router/route.tsx rename to packages/core/src/components/route/route.tsx index 3c9b2bd145..66ef0a4c69 100644 --- a/packages/core/src/components/router/route.tsx +++ b/packages/core/src/components/route/route.tsx @@ -1,5 +1,5 @@ import { Component, Event, EventEmitter, Prop } from '@stencil/core'; -import { RouterEntry, parseURL } from './router-utils'; +import { RouterEntry, parseURL } from '../router-controller/router-utils'; @Component({ diff --git a/packages/core/src/components/router/test/router-utils.spec.ts b/packages/core/src/components/route/test/router-utils.spec.ts similarity index 100% rename from packages/core/src/components/router/test/router-utils.spec.ts rename to packages/core/src/components/route/test/router-utils.spec.ts diff --git a/packages/core/src/components/router-controller/readme.md b/packages/core/src/components/router-controller/readme.md new file mode 100644 index 0000000000..4e372692dc --- /dev/null +++ b/packages/core/src/components/router-controller/readme.md @@ -0,0 +1,11 @@ +# ion-router-controller + + + + + + + +---------------------------------------------- + +*Built by [StencilJS](https://stenciljs.com/)* diff --git a/packages/core/src/components/router/router-controller.tsx b/packages/core/src/components/router-controller/router-controller.tsx similarity index 99% rename from packages/core/src/components/router/router-controller.tsx rename to packages/core/src/components/router-controller/router-controller.tsx index a1bf878ca8..11c75b5649 100644 --- a/packages/core/src/components/router/router-controller.tsx +++ b/packages/core/src/components/router-controller/router-controller.tsx @@ -2,6 +2,7 @@ import { Component, Listen, Prop } from '@stencil/core'; import { RouterSegments, generateURL, parseURL, readNavState, writeNavState } from './router-utils'; import { Config } from '../../index'; + @Component({ tag: 'ion-router-controller' }) diff --git a/packages/core/src/components/router/router-utils.tsx b/packages/core/src/components/router-controller/router-utils.tsx similarity index 100% rename from packages/core/src/components/router/router-utils.tsx rename to packages/core/src/components/router-controller/router-utils.tsx diff --git a/packages/core/src/index.d.ts b/packages/core/src/index.d.ts index 3c320de30c..591f96f32e 100644 --- a/packages/core/src/index.d.ts +++ b/packages/core/src/index.d.ts @@ -118,7 +118,7 @@ export { RouterEntry, RouterEntries, NavState, -} from './components/router/router-utils'; +} from './components/router-controller/router-utils'; export { Row } from './components/row/row'; export { ItemReorder } from './components/reorder/reorder'; export { Scroll, ScrollCallback, ScrollDetail } from './components/scroll/scroll';